In May 2005, the City Council considered a request to waive the requirement to install
sidewalk for a two-lot subdivision, located two blocks east of this subdivision on the
northeast corner of Garden Road and Willowbrook Circle. Approximately 250 feet of
sidewalk was required along Garden Road, and approximately 283 feet of sidewalk was
required along Willowbrook Circle. The City Manager had recommended that installation of
the sidewalk be deferred, and that an agreement be executed between the applicant and
the City, accompanied by financial security to cover the estimated cost of sidewalk
installation. The City Council chose to grant the request of the applicant, and waived the
requirement for installation of the sidewalk.
After approval of this subdivision, there will be 11 properties on the north side of Garden
Road between South Duff Avenue and the beginning of sidewalk at 501 Garden Road.
Three of the 11 properties are included in the proposed subdivision. If sidewalk had been
required for the two-lot subdivision at Garden Road and Willowbrook Circle, installation of
sidewalk for this subdivision would now have provided sidewalk on nearly one-half of the
properties on the north side of the street, in this 2-1/2 block stretch of Garden Road.

The City's subdivision regulations require the installation of sidewalks in new subdivisions,
but provide for the "deferment" of the installation of sidewalk in new subdivisions where
installation of sidewalk is premature (Section 23.403).
Section 23.403(14)(a) of the Municipal Code states the following:
(14) Sidewalks and Walkways.
(a) Sidewalks and walkways shall be designed to provide convenient access to all
properties and shall connect to the City-wide sidewalk system. A minimum of a
four-foot wide concrete sidewalk shall be installed in the public right-of-way
along each side of any street within residentially and commercially zoned areas
and along at least one side of any street within industrially zoned areas. Such a
sidewalk shall connect with any sidewalk within the area to be subdivided and
with any existing or proposed sidewalk in any adjacent area. Any required
sidewalk shall be constructed of concrete and be at least four feet wide.
(i) A .deferment for the installation of sidewalks may be granted by the City
Council when topographic conditions exist that make the sidewalk installation
difficult or when the installation of the sidewalk is premature. Where the
installation of a sidewalk is deferred by the City Council, an agreement will
be executed between the property owner/developer and the City of Ames
that will ensure the future installation of the sidewalk. The deferment
agreement will be accompanied by a cash escrow, letter of credit, or other
form of acceptable financial security to cover the cost of the installation of the
sidewalk.

Given the adopted policy for the installation of sidewalk, as described in Section 23.403
(14)(a) of the Municipal Code, and the safety concerns, as described in this report, for
pedestrians and children near the intersection of South Duff Avenue and Garden Road,
staff does not support a waiver or deferral, but instead,supports installation of the sidewalk
along Garden Road and along South Duff Avenue for this entire three-lot subdivision.
If the City Council chooses to grant a deferral of the sidewalk installation, it will be required
that the applicant provide financial security to cover the future cost of sidewalk installation.
The amount of financial security that would be required is based on an estimated cost of
$15.00 per lineal foot of sidewalk. The total cost for the installation of sidewalk along
Garden Road and along South Duff Avenue for this three-lot subdivision is$5,058 (337.23
lineal feet multiplied by $15.00 per lineal foot of sidewalk).

MANAGER'S RECOMMENDED ACTION:
Until recently,the subdivision regulations required a developer to install sidewalks on both
sides of a street. However, the City Council began receiving more and more requests to
waive the sidewalk requirement for both sides of a street because of the additional cost or
because the required sidewalk would not connect with an existing segment. Therefore, in
May 2004,the City Council adopted a new deferral option as an alternative to total waivers.
Staff is unable to conclude, as required by the ordinance, that a requirement to install
sidewalks will result in extraordinary hardship or will prove inconsistent with the purpose of
the sidewalk regulations due to unusual topography or other conditions. In fact, the
installation of sidewalks now will provide a safer pedestrian environment for the three
families living in these homes. This could also be a step towards the eventual completion
of sidewalks along Garden Road, which is the recommended elementary school walking
route for this area.
Therefore, it is the recommendation of the City Manager that the City Council adopt
Alternative No. 1., to deny the applicant's request to waive the requirement for the
installation of sidewalk at 107, 113, and 117 Garden Road, and require the installation of
sidewalk along South Duff Avenue and along Garden Road for the lot at 107 Garden Road,
and along Garden Road for the lots at 113 and 117 Garden Road, prior to the issuance of
an occupancy permit as each house is built.
